动态执行是通过预测指令流和数据流,调整指令的执行顺序,最大地发挥CPU内部各部件的功效,提高系统执行指令的速度。
动态执行主要采用了:
多路分支预测:利用转移预测技术允许程序几个分支流同时在处理器内执行;
数据流分析:通过分析指令数据的相关性,把指令进行优化排序后执行,充分利用处理器内部资源;
推测执行:根据各推测最终的正确性,对多个分支的运行结果进行取舍。
(简答题)
什么叫动态执行?使用动态执行技术会带来什么好处?
正确答案
答案解析
略
相似试题
(简答题)
什么叫动态执行?使用动态执行技术会带来什么好处?
(简答题)
什么叫推测执行?什么叫动态分支预测?
(填空题)
在控制指令中使用PC相对寻址方式会带来许多优点,可以有效地缩短(),可以使代码在执行时()。
(单选题)
执行动态网页time.asp的操作是()
(判断题)
动态网页是在客户端执行的。
(简答题)
什么叫超顺序执行技术?它主要体现在哪些方面?采用该技术需要有什么硬件支持?
(单选题)
PowerBuilder9.0中,用于生成可执行文件、动态链接库、组件和代理对象的是()
(简答题)
什么叫动态查找?什么叫静态查找?什么样的存储结构适宜于进行静态查找?什么样的存储结构适宜于进行动态查找?
(简答题)
什么叫动态显示?